Objective: Send a message in slack everytime a task is transferred to a particular stage

Set-up:

Trigger: Asana - Updated task in project

Filter: Asana - Continue if section name exactly matches Approved

Action - Slack - send message

 

Challenge:  Trigger is not working. “

Your Zap would not have continued” error comes up during setup

Hey there @anonymous porcupine!

In the Zap editor, when you test a filter, the message “Your Zap would not have continued” means that the test data in the Zap doesn’t match the conditions of the filter. 

If you look at the section name in the data that came in when you tested the Zap trigger, does it say ‘Approved’? If it doesn’t, that means that the filter is working as it should; it would have stopped the Zap if that task triggered the Zap. 

 

You can learn more about how Filters work in this help doc. Section 3 in the guide shows what you’ll see when you test a filter step.
